Kiel – Statistics & current form

The host from Kiel is right in the middle of the 2nd Bundesliga. Holstein came well from the winter break, already showing in the first competitive matches that the good impressions from the test games were no accident. Coach Ole Werner, who took over the team in October, has a good influence on the team.

Kiel faced some problems against Darmstadt, but especially in Karlsruhe they played objectively, concentrated forward and showed themselves efficient in the last third. The problem in some games is still the lack of balance. The risk on the offensive is then sometimes too high, and fast counterattacks threaten. Therefore, before the game Kiel vs. St. Pauli our prediction that both teams will score.

Especially the integration of Jae-sung Lee on the offensive is currently very good. In Karlsruhe, the South Korean acted as a center forward, but at times dropped back into midfield and served players like Porath & Co. very well. It is interesting that Kiel is often struggling at home. The last home win comes from October, when VfL Bochum could be defeated. Only two of the nine home games were won, which is a much poorer record than abroad.

However, the latest developments in Kiel should serve as encouragement. The team goes through a development process under coach Werner, the squad is also very well staffed, especially in the width. Before the game Kiel vs. St. Pauli also shows the betting odds that a home win is anything but unrealistic and yet the odds are still tempting.

The personnel situation at Kiel is also relaxed. With Jannik Dehm a strong right-back is missing, but otherwise Ole Werner can draw on the full. Many changes are not necessary after the victory in Karlsruhe, the fast Iyoha is an option for the offensive.

St. Pauli – Statistics & current form

After a good final sprint in 2019, when two wins in a row were won, the year 2020 started rather slowly for St. Pauli. The 0: 3 in Fürth was sometimes an oath of revelation because almost everything was missing. But the 1-1 draw against Stuttgart gave hope again. These two games showed one thing in particular: St. Pauli is very inconsistent!

And what face does the team of coach Jos Luhukay show in the north duel in Kiel? That remains to be seen, but generally the away record is a disaster this season. Precisely because the guests are still waiting for their first win abroad, Kiel vs. St. Pauli’s look at the odds of a home win.

Four draws and five defeats – that’s the score of the guests in the previous away games. In addition, St. Pauli only scored eight goals in these nine games. It is therefore not surprising that one has to deal with the relegation battle at the moment. Demand and reality are currently very different.

The team repeatedly shows that it is good at playing football and against it. Against Stuttgart, a favorite for promotion, St. Pauli kept up well and could have won with a bit more luck.

What is particularly painful is the loss of central defender and captain Avevor, who is suffering from a broken fibula. It will only be available again in the final sprint and of course leaves a big gap. This is particularly evident when St. Pauli is constantly exposed to opposing pressure. The automatisms in the current defensive line-up are not fully established, too often individual errors cause goals to be conceded.

After the 1-1 draw against Stuttgart, Jos Luhukay should be reasonably satisfied. So big changes in the starting eleven do not have to be made. Buchtmann, who can be dangerous with his good technique and solid passing especially on the counterattack, could move into the team for Sobota, the fast Lankford is an option for Gyökeres.

Kiel vs St. Pauli Direct comparison & statistics highlights

So far, Kiel and St. Pauli have faced each other directly in 15 duels. The host took four wins, and the two teams drew four times. This means that the direct comparison goes to St. Pauli, who won seven times. The club from Hamburg also won the first leg 2-1, before that Kiel won two games in a row (2-1, 1-0)
